Mercury below normal in Punjab, Haryana

Image

Press Trust of India Chandigarh
The maximum temperatures today stayed below the normal level in most parts of Haryana and Punjab.

The union territory of Chandigarh recorded a maximum temperature of 37.8 degrees Celsius, two notches below normal, the MeT department said.

Ambala in Haryana recorded a high of 38.6 degrees Celsius, while the maximum temperature at both Hisar and Karnal settled at 38.4 degree Celsius, four notches below normal.

In Punjab, Amritsar's high was 39 degrees Celsius, while the maximum temperatures of Ludhiana and Patiala were 37.4 degrees Celsius and 40 degrees Celsius respectively.

The MeT department has forecast rains or thundershowers at isolated places of the two states in the next 24 hours.
